It would be very useful, in my code, to interrogate the size of a Queue in an ISR. Looking at the code I can’t see why this would be a problem. Is the below code a valid implementation?
UBaseTypet uxQueueSpacesAvailableFromISR( const QueueHandlet xQueue )
{
UBaseTypet uxReturn;
uxReturn = ( ( Queuet * ) xQueue )->uxLength – ( ( Queue_t * ) xQueue )->uxMessagesWaiting;
return uxReturn;
}
Can anyone see any potential problems with this? Am I missing something obvious?
